Push in Fittings
Push-in fittings provide a fast, secure, and reliable method of connecting tubing in pneumatic compressed air systems. Designed for quick installation without tools, they allow tubing to be connected and disconnected easily while maintaining a tight, leak-free seal.
Commonly used in industrial automation, manufacturing, workshops, and engineering environments, push-in fittings are ideal for applications where speed, flexibility, and reliability are essential. Available in a wide range of configurations, including straight connectors, elbows, tees, reducers, and threaded adapters, they support efficient system layout and easy modification.
Suitable for compressed air and pneumatic control systems, push-in fittings offer a compact and professional solution for connecting tubing to valves, cylinders, air preparation equipment, and manifolds.
